An initiative to renew and extend the relations between the National Cancer Centre of Mongolia (NCCM) and Geneva University Hospitals (HUG) was proposed by the Embassy of Mongolia in Switzerland beginning from September 2022.

Since then, reciprocal visits of the leadership of both hospitals were implemented successfully in Ulaanbaatar and in Geneva in 2023, as well as onsite and online coordination meetings between the staffs of the two hospitals and the Embassy were held regularly.

As a result of this ongoing active and fruitful cooperation, the two sides established Memorandum of Understanding between NCCM and HUG to engage into the next phase of cooperation on September 17th, 2024.

The MOU was signed by Director General N. Erdenekhu representing the NCCM and Director General Robert Mardini representing HUG.

Within the framework of the MOU the next phase of cooperation encompasses the following:

• The exchange of knowledge and expertise between the two institutions, with HUG sharing its experience with advanced treatments and their side effects and learning from the NCCM on the high volume of specific cases it handles.

• HUG will host Mongolian oncologists and surgeons for three-month training periods in Geneva, focusing on practical skills and advanced treatments, while Swiss experts will continue visiting Mongolia to provide hands-on training and support.
